All about cars

INSITE A new website to “experience” a car before you buy it

Carazoo.com, said to be the country’s first car portal with interactive animations, has signed up with 150 dealers across India and is looking at more tie-ups across the country. To further enhance the “user experience”, more interactive animations have been added to the portal.

Now, with a 360 degree exterior view, the interior view is also available, enabling viewers a “virtual touch and feel experience”, say the organisers. The website gives you a “paint your car” option too. If the browser registers himself on the portal there “is a chance to win prizes and get services such as email alerts and access to Car Mantra.”
